Understanding the Scam Behind 0430 295 806
Reports about the phone number 0430 295 806 / 0430295806 suggest it is connected to a deceptive automated voice scam aimed at tricking individuals into divulging personal information. Specifically, users have noted receiving calls that falsely claim their Amazon Prime subscription is due for renewal, a service they do not subscribe to. This tactic is commonly employed by scammers to instil a sense of urgency and confusion, leading victims to inadvertently provide sensitive details.
The Nature of the Scam
This type of call is classified as a phishing attempt, where the goal is to extract personal information, such as credit card numbers, login credentials, or other sensitive data. The automated voice message can make it seem official, even mimicking real notification systems, thereby preying on unsuspecting individuals.
How to Handle Calls from 0430 295 806
If you receive a call from this number, it’s essential to remain vigilant:
- Do not engage with the call: Hang up immediately if you feel the call is suspicious.
- Do not share personal information: Legitimate companies will never ask for sensitive details over the phone.
- Report the incident: Notify the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) or the Australian Cyber Security Centre (ACSC) about the scam.
